This graph reveals the calculated transmission of the uncoated calcium fluoride window at normal incidence.
In dry environments, CaF2 may be used as much as 1000 °C, but inside the presence of dampness, degradation will manifest for temperatures exceeding 600 °C. Each and every window provides a randomly oriented crystal axis.

The fluorite composition can be a variety of crystal construction where calcium ions sort a encounter-centered cubic lattice and fluoride ions fill each of the tetrahedral web-sites, making a cubic arrangement. This composition is characteristic with the mineral fluorite, from which it will get its name.
